ISO 1825:2026

Rubber hoses and hose assemblies for aircraft ground fuelling and defuelling - Specification

This document specifies the dimensions and construction of, and requirements for, four types of hose and hose assembly for use in all operations associated with the ground fuelling and defuelling of aircraft.

 

All four types are designed for:

 
     
  1. use with petroleum fuels having an aromatic-hydrocarbon content not exceeding 30 % by volume;
  2.  
  3. operation within the temperature range of 30 °C to +65 °C and such that they will be undamaged by climatic conditions of 40 °C to +70 °C when stored in static conditions. For LT hose, the temperature range of 40 °C to +65 °C and such that they will be undamaged by climatic conditions of 48 °C to +70 °C when stored in static conditions;
  4.  
  5. operation at up to 2,0 MPa (20 bar) maximum working pressure, including surges of pressure which the hose can be subjected to in service.
